Reports Q1 revenue $840M, consensus $816.38M. Paul Abbott, Chief Executive Officer: “Our financial performance and continued commercial progress in Q1 was strong. Our next-gen Egencia, powered by Agentic AI, and strategic alliance with SAP Concur on Complete are reshaping how enterprises manage travel and expense globally. Total New Wins Value of $3.4 billion and 96% customer retention demonstrate the strength of our offerings and customer relationships.”
